Fire Sprinkler Designer

S&S Midwest Fire Protection LLC – Worthington, OH 43085

Job Summary

We are seeking an experienced, detail‑oriented Fire Sprinkler Designer to design and develop fire protection sprinkler systems in compliance with applicable codes and project requirements. The Fire Sprinkler Designer will be responsible for accurate shop drawings, hydraulic calculations, and material submittals. This role requires strong technical knowledge, problem solving skills, and the ability to manage multiple projects.

Responsibilities Design & Drafting
  • Develop detailed fire sprinkler system designs using software such as Revit and Auto Sprink.
  • Design Fire Sprinkler Systems to meet the requirements of the AHJ, State Building Codes, and NFPA Standards.
  • Hydraulically calculate fire protection systems using the most recent hydraulics software.
  • Review and interpret Architectural, Structural, MEP, and Civil Drawings.
Project Management & Coordination
  • Manage all aspects of the project design from conception to completion.
  • Coordinate fire sprinkler projects using the latest 3D BIM modeling software and techniques such as Navisworks.
  • Collaborate with project teams during the construction phase to resolve design issues and provide technical support.
  • Communicate with MEP contractors and General Contractors for final design coordination.
  • Prepare submittal packages including permit drawing sets, material & equipment manuals, and final As‑Built drawings.
  • Stock list/Order all material for sprinkler systems from the completed/coordinated designs for fabrication and on‑time delivery.
Field & Technical Support
  • Perform field surveys, water flow tests, job site visits, and gather feedback from the field to aid in design/installation accuracy.
  • Assist Sales/Estimating team with preliminary site surveys, hydraulic calculations, pricing change orders, reviewing RFIs, estimating design labor on projects, and design technical support.
Qualifications
  • 3-5 years of experience in Fire Sprinkler Design (minimum).
  • Formal education in engineering preferred, but not required.
  • Nicet certification (any level) in Water Based Systems Layout.
  • Software proficiency in Microsoft Office, Revit, Auto Sprink, and Navisworks.
  • Excellent interpersonal, communication, teamwork, and leadership skills.
